iOS项目开发实战——UILabel与取色器的使用
2015-09-25 16:45
417 查看
iOS中UILabel是开发中使用最基本的控件,如果是在storyboard中,我们可以方便的进行拖拽。但是通过代码我们如何实现呢?
代码如下:
在这里,我要向大家推荐一款mac上十分方便的取色器,sip,可以在App Store上免费下载。获取的颜色可以直接在代码中进行复制,会直接生成颜色的代码。十分方便。
。
程序运行效果如下:
.
github主页:https://github.com/chenyufeng1991 。欢迎大家访问!
代码如下:
#import "ViewController.h" @interface ViewController () @end @implementation ViewController - (void)viewDidLoad { [super viewDidLoad]; UILabel *label = [[UILabel alloc] init]; label.frame = CGRectMake(30, 30, 100, 20); //label的颜色默认是透明的,就是说一定要设置Label的颜色,否则不可见; //参数的值为0-1; //这里推荐使用一款免费的软件,sip,可以在App Store下载到;用来进行屏幕的取色;可以直接进行颜色值的复制粘贴; label.backgroundColor = [UIColor colorWithRed:0.48 green:0.83 blue:0.98 alpha:1]; label.text = @"Hello"; label.textColor = [UIColor redColor]; label.textAlignment = NSTextAlignmentCenter; [self.view addSubview:label]; } @end
在这里,我要向大家推荐一款mac上十分方便的取色器,sip,可以在App Store上免费下载。获取的颜色可以直接在代码中进行复制,会直接生成颜色的代码。十分方便。
。
程序运行效果如下:
.
github主页:https://github.com/chenyufeng1991 。欢迎大家访问!
相关文章推荐
- UI标签库的话题:JEECG智能开发平台 BaseTag(样式表和JS标签的引入)
- Blue Jeans---poj3080(kmp+暴力求子串)
- UINavigationController方法pushViewController:参数不能传递UITabBarController原因猜想
- easyui 重复提交url
- CRM-数据库查询助手QueryHelper
- 一款运行在Bluemix上的小游戏 - 2048
- iOS项目开发实战——UIView的层级关系
- Cstyle的UEFI导读:第21.0篇 UEFI的N种实现及差别
- UGUI与NGUI的区别与优缺点
- Could not connect to ASM due to following error ORA-01031:insufficient privileges
- easyui datagrid edit 取消单行,多行文本框编辑
- IPv6 tutorial – Part 7: Zone ID and unique local IPv6 unicast addresses
- iOS项目开发实战——UIView的子视图和父视图
- It is indirectly referenced from required .class files错误查找的解决办法如下
- UItableview全部属性、方法以及代理方法执行顺序
- ORA-00304: requested INSTANCE_NUMBER is busy
- Light oj 1126 - Building Twin Towers(dp)
- Android samples API Demos之UI篇3(Activitytasks——DocumentCentricRelinquishIdentity)
- UITableViewCell删除按钮的背景颜色,字体大小可以改变吗?
- 再谈select, iocp, epoll,kqueue及各种I/O复用机制